I was just saying that the H105 might not fit in the bitfenix case as it is thicker than a H100i. The radiator is 11mm thicker so it could present problems. I still think a H60 or a H80i would be more than enough.

I would go for 2 x 4GB Ram otherwise you won't get dual channel mode  :D

That's what i thought, but after considering it and thinking "What would i do and buy?" I came to the conclusion that going with one 8Gb stick and another 8Gb stick later (Mobo only supports 2 slots), that would be more than enough (i'm also a tab monster :D)
